What are some inspiring quotes about death and life?

Many quotes about death and life, while not specifically found within cemeteries, resonate deeply with the feelings evoked by visiting a cemetery. These quotes often speak to the cyclical nature of life, the preciousness of time, and the importance of living a meaningful existence. Consider these examples:

  • "What we have once enjoyed we can never lose. All that we love deeply becomes a part of us." – Helen Keller: This quote speaks to the enduring power of memory and how our loved ones continue to live on within us.
  • "The best and most beautiful things in the world cannot be seen or even touched - they must be felt with the heart." – Helen Keller: This quote reminds us of the intangible beauty of life, love, and the memories we cherish.
  • "Not how long, but how well you have lived is the main thing." – Seneca: This quote emphasizes the quality of life over its length, urging us to focus on living a meaningful and fulfilling life.

What are some uplifting quotes about remembrance?

The act of remembering loved ones is central to the experience of visiting a cemetery. Many quotes beautifully capture the essence of remembrance and the ongoing connection we feel with those who have passed. For example:

  • "To live in hearts we leave behind is not to die." – Thomas Campbell: This quote eloquently expresses the immortality achieved through the love and memories we leave behind. It speaks to the enduring legacy of a life well-lived.
  • "Though your body is gone, your spirit lives on in our hearts." – Anonymous: This sentiment is often expressed in personal epitaphs and captures the lasting impact loved ones have on our lives.
  • "Memory is a way of holding onto the things you love, the things you are, the things you never want to lose." – Unknown: This quote speaks directly to the power of memory in preserving the essence of loved ones and cherished moments.

What are some good quotes for a headstone?

Choosing a quote for a headstone is a deeply personal decision. The best quotes are those that authentically reflect the deceased's personality, beliefs, and life. Simple, heartfelt messages are often the most effective. Avoid overly long or complex quotes that might be difficult to read or understand. Consider quotes that emphasize their virtues, their impact on others, or their faith. The most important factor is that the chosen words resonate deeply with the bereaved and serve as a lasting tribute to the loved one's memory.
